..... Am on day one of recovery, pain is minimimal due to very good pain relief tablets. My nose feels blocked though, presume with dried blood, but am only allowed to clean the outside so how does this go away?! Would love to hear from others going through this or those who have been through before.. no horror stories though please!!!!! x

"Hi hun"
Posted by hevs1 26 August  at  12:55

... i know exactly how you feel. I had my nose done in January and although i didnt really feel any pain afterwards it was more the uncomfortable blocked feeling that i didnt like. They told me I couldnt blow my nose for two weeks afterwards!

As i didnt have any splints inside my nose i was given a saline solution to put in my nose to get rid of the dried blood. The thing i found most helpful though was a product called Sterimar which you can buy from chemist, this will make you feel much better.

Hope that helps x

"Hi"
Posted by astra180 30 August  at  14:16

Just wanted to say that I hope you are happy with the results straight away, but dont worry if ur not. There will be alot of swelling but it does go down. I was really emotional for weeks after, regretting what i had done to myself, and that it wasn't that bad before etc. It took me about 6 months to finally be happy with it and accept my new nose. It didnt help that other people kept telling me that it wasn't bad before and couldnt give a definite yes to me when i asked if it looked better now. I only told a few people and no-one else has noticed or at least not mentioned it to me or my family. However, the other day my mum told me that my dad had said how it did look better now so that made me feel better too. He's not the type to be able to tell me himself bless him! Like i said, hopefully you'll like urs straight away but really dont worry if you dont. It'll all settle in the end. Best of luck.x
